Karim Benzema blames sex tape scandal for France omission and says he has ‘no chance’ playing again with Didier Deschamps in charge

Real Madrid striker could be right: Deschamps has suggested Benzema would risk 'harmony' of team

KARIM BENZEMA is convinced is international career is on hold as long as Didier Deschamps manages France.

Benzema, 29, believes his two-year exile is down to his alleged role in blackmailing international teammate Mathieu Valbuena over a sex tape.

The Real Madrid striker was arrested as part of the investigation into the scandal.

Deschamps suggested in May that bringing Benzema in would put the "harmony" of the team at risk.

But Benzema insists he shouldn't be victimised on the basis of a non-football matter.

"It could be that, of course, there were stories before with the sex-tape affair and that could be it," he told

"But, personally, I think what is external to football you have to leave out. It's best to win titles.

"Everybody has gotten involved and we have forgotten football. It has been two years since I've played.

"I don't have any problem with the coach, but as long as he's here, I don't think I'll have a chance.

"We forgot the athlete and what I can bring in. Public opinion has been able to weigh in.

"But we do not need that to win titles; it is possible that Deschamps has been put under pressure."

Former Lyon star Benzema does not expect to be part of the squad for the 2018 World Cup.

He said: "It's complicated for me to be at the World Cup, don't be silly, of course I want to, I'm a football lover, and I like that pressure.

"I have no problems with any player in the France team, there are some that I come across and it's always good to see them, I'm not a disrupter, I have a public image that isn't good.
